Today we will take a winery tour on the route des Vins d’Alsace. Meet the local wine makers and learn about Alsace’s history and sample grape varieties at the vineyard.
The Alsatian wine route offers a true picture-postcard image; fresh vines climbing to the forests of the Vosges, ruins of castles dating back to the Middle Ages, villages with old ramparts and lively cellars. We will also enjoy a picnic style lunch at the vineyard.

Fly to Aberdeen where we will transfer to The Fife Arms Hotel. The hotel is located in the historic Scottish village of Braemar amidst the majestic landscape of the Cairngorms National Park. Built in the 19th century, the hotel is evidence of Queen Victoria’s visits and her purchase of Balmoral.
Throughout Scotland there are many different castles with varying architecture and stories. Braemar is home to two castles, Braemar Castle and Kindrochit castle (ruin).
Dating as far back as 1628, Braemar castle has a colorful history including the first and second Jacobite uprising. With our local guide we will visit these castles including the Balmoral Castle.
Known as the Scottish home to the Royal Family, Balmoral castle was originally purchased by Prince Albert for Queen Victoria in 1852.
